Craig
7/20/2007 10:58:28 AM
I went to set my time and learned that the minutes are set via GPS and you can only adjust the hours to accommodate DST.
Craig
DN27
7/21/2007 11:56:54 AM
I can set the minutes on my clock. No Nav.
